[Treatment of uterine leiomyoma with depot leuprorelin acetate (Enantone-Gyn monthly depot). Effect on leiomyoma volume and operability. German Leuprorelin Study Group].
In an open, non-comparative clinical phase IV multicentre study the efficacy and safety of the GnRH agonist leuprorelin acetate depot (LAD) for patients with at least one symptomatic uterine leiomyoma was assessed. 144 premenopausal patients were enrolled and treated with up to six injections of 3.75 mg LAD/month subcutaneously prior to surgical intervention, e.g. either hysterectomy or myoma enucleation. Due to a profound suppression of serum-estradiol levels to castration range (< or = 30 pg/ml) an average volume reduction of all myomas from 86.6 +/- 101.3 ml to 38.5 +/- 63.5 ml became obvious for 90% of all patients. In parallel a significant shrinkage of uterine volume was observed. ⋯ Treatment was generally well tolerated. Most of the observed side effects were related to hypoestrogenism. The results of this study have shown that medical pretreatment for patients with uterine fibroids with LAD prior to surgical intervention is an effective measure to improve operability and could lead for several patients to minimal invasive surgery.

Survey about oral contraceptives and postmenopausal hormonal replacement therapy and the effects on coagulation system. The question to withdraw oral contraceptives 4 weeks before a gynecological operation cannot be answered sufficiently. ⋯ It can be anticipated, that this rule will be changed in future. There are no scientific hints, which could bring a phlebitis or varicosis in connection etiologically with a thromboembolic disorder during oral contraceptives.

[Gameprost, sulproston and dinoproston for induced abortion in the 15th-24th week of pregnancy].
In a randomized, prospective study at the Dept. of Obstetrics and Gynecology of the University Hospital of Giessen 4 different ways of inducing abortions with prostaglandins were tested between the 15th and 24th week of gestation. The aim of the study was to determine the best approach to inducing abortion in order to minimize the psychological and physical stress to the patient. Subjects randomized to the first two groups got a single cervical installation of either 0.5 mg Dinoprostongel (Prepidil, N = 22) or 0.5 mg Sulprostongel (Nalador, N = 21). ⋯ We conclude that repetitive application of Gemeprost vaginal suppositories decreases the time to abortion and subject discomfort tremendously. The application of Gemeprost suppositories provides the easiest and most efficient therapeutic approach for both patients and staff. Furthermore the regiment that provided the best results was also the most cost-effective (range 180,-DM to 317,- DM per case).

[Ablative versus conservative therapy of operable breast cancer].
Review about operative management of breast cancer. Comparison between breast preserving therapy and mastectomy in respect of the results of the studies of Veroneti and B. Fisher.

[Effect of Urapidil in antihypertensive therapy of preeclampsia on newborns].
For the therapy of preeclamptic patients is Urapidil besides Dihydralazine another possible option for iv-therapy with good results in first clinical studies. Effects of both drugs on the newborns were observed. - ⋯ With Urapaidil we have another therapeutic option in preeclampsia where we could not show any negative side-effects on the newborns.
